Curtis Island National Park

The island features coastal heaths, littoral rainforest, sand dunes and beach ridges and salt flats.[2] The national park encompasses the Cape Capricorn headland.

No facilities are provided for campers. Bush camping is permitted in three camp grounds.

The island is home to a variety of bird species.[3]

The average elevation of the terrain is 16 metres.[4]
